Jaimie Lauren Cupcakery and Confections in Wax - Legally Blonde
Scent Description: Iced champagne mixed with sweet raspberry and cranberry.
I don't get anything very fizzy here, but everything else from a typical Blond Moment blend is there.
Date Received: Some time June 2013. What? No, I don't hoard my stash.
Weight Melted: 1.7 oz
Location of Warmer: Living Room
Cold Sniff: 4/5 I quite enjoy blond moment blends without their fizzy component. How convenient that this tart lacks that fizz!
Warm Sniff: 4/5 No surprises once melted.
Scent Strength: 1.5/3
Scent Throw: 2/3 Filled most of the living room.
Melting Power: 5/5 I got about 10 hours of scent from this tart before the scent died off.
Repurchase: Yes! If Jen's blend this time around is the same blond moment sans fizzy notes, I will definitely want some more! It's so nice to finally say I can reorder from JLCCW if I want to.

JLCCW - Avalon
Scent Description: Tahitian Waterfall and Vanilla Bean Noel are what's in here, if my research has turned up correct results. These two combine to create a very relaxing scent.
Weight Melted: 1.2 oz.
Cold Sniff: 3/5 I was uncertain when I first smelled this. It was something 'green' and a little perfumey, but that's all I could really think of to describe it.
Warm Sniff: 5/5 I loved this as it melted. I can only describe it as relaxing. Towards the end I did notice that the VBN faded off quite a bit.
Scent Strength: 2/3 The Tahitian Waterfall is a little too strong for this to be a downright background scent.
Scent Throw: 5/5 It filled the entire apartment with its loveliness.
Melting Power: 4/5 I got 16 hours out of this fella before switching it out for another melt.
Repurchase: Yes, but I can't. Insert long rant about how much I miss JLCCW right here.
